18-38. PUMP-TO-MANIFOLD HOSE REMOVAL AND REPLACEMENT (TRUCKS
M49A1C and M49A2C).
TOOLS: 3/4-inch wrench (2)
3/8-inch drive ratchet set
Flat-tip screwdriver
Pump-to-manifold hose
SUPPLIES:
Pump-to-manifold hose upper gasket
Pump-to-manifold hose lower gasket
Diesel fuel
PERSONNEL:
One
Truck parked, engine off, handbrake set.
EUQIPMENT
CONDITION:
WARNING
Smoking, sparks or open flame are not allowed
within 50 feet of fuel truck during this task.
Fuel may burn, causing explosion, injury to
personnel, and damage to equipment.
a.
Removal.
FRAME 1
Open fuel truck rear compartment doors.
1.
Using 3/4-inch wrenches, unscrew and take off four nuts (1) and four
2.
screws (2).
3.
Lift up lower pipe (3) and take off and throw away gasket (4).
